I posted recently that I had identified a faulty RAM chip in my VT100 and
having replaced it the terminal seemed to get further into the self test.
After further analysis with the logic analyser I have realised that it is
still failing the RAM test, despite an apparent change in behaviour. I think
the change in behaviour could be simply due to the slightly suspect keyboard
cable.
But here is the puzzle. When I first identified the faulty RAM chip if found
that address 0x2408 would read back as 0x0A instead of 0xAA. I reckon this
equates to E50 in the schematic, as it is the upper nibble of the second
bank of RAM. I replaced the chip with one I bought recently. It turns out
the self-test is still failing at the SAME address.
I find this really hard to explain. It can't be the chip selection logic
because then the addresses 0x2400-0x2407 would also fail and I checked the
CS signal with the logic analyser just to be sure. I also checked the
address lines directly on the RAM chip for any stuck bits and they seemed
fine too.
What are the chances of two 2114 chips failing at exactly the same address?
Is there some failure mode I might not be considering?
Thanks
Rob
Show replies by date